Kochi Metro Rail to achieve 60% energy neutrality
The installation of rooftop solar panels will be completed by mid-November 2020 Kochi Metro Rail (KMRL) will be achieving 60% energy neutrality shortly by utilising solar energy. The Metro agency will be commissioning an additional 5.4 MWp capacity system on its buildings and tracks in 2020 to increase the output to 1.57 crore units per […]

Indonesia to install rooftop solar panels on 800 public buildings
The Indonesian government plans to install rooftop solar panels on at least 800 public buildings across the country this year as it steps up its renewable energy push to lessen its reliance on fossil fuels. NDMC to install rooftop solar panels to save on power bills
The North Delhi Municipal Corporation (NDMC) plans to set up rooftop solar panels on the civic body-owned buildings to save on electricity bills worth around Rs 9 lakh per month.
